Output 50d3b329bc89a72ee21a264ab3c5fa6332ce6aaac435fc4cc3e704f4d75fe929:0

value
65903
script pubkey
OP_0 OP_PUSHBYTES_20 905dda7f457899036c448fdce5e35474802355eb
address
tb1qjpwa5l690zvsxmzy3lwwtc65wjqzx40t49uk38
transaction
50d3b329bc89a72ee21a264ab3c5fa6332ce6aaac435fc4cc3e704f4d75fe929